titleOfInvention Color image information converter
abstract (57) [Abstract] [Purpose] To provide an apparatus capable of providing image information representing a color with high accuracy by using a small number of color patches. [Configuration] Using three or more gray patches having different densities, a conversion formula for converting image information to be evaluated including optical information into lightness spatial information with equiproportion to human eyes is determined, and the gray patches are determined. Based on a calibration method determined based on the conversion formula, image information to be evaluated including optical information and position information is provided with color information including lightness information, chroma information, and hue information, which are equal to human eyes. The image information calculation is performed to perform the calculation processing for converting into.
